Step-by-Step Guide: What to Expect When You Work With a Criminal Lawyer in Denver

Knowing the procedure can reduce your stress and help you make better decisions. While every situation is one-of-a-kind, most Denver criminal issues follow a similar path from arrest to resolution. Right here is a clear, detailed consider how a defense attorney typically guides you via the system.

Immediate consultation and instance intake. After an apprehension or a notification to appear, your initial step is an extensive discussion with your lawyer. You review the charges, where and when the event occurred, your criminal history (if any kind of), migration status, and present concerns like job or child care. The lawyer pays attention initially, then clarifies the optimum fines and realistic opportunities based upon Denver and Colorado law. Gathering cops records and evidence. Your lawyer requests exploration from the prosecutor, consisting of authorities reports, body video camera video footage, 911 recordings, witness declarations, laboratory results, and any type of images or videos. In DUI instances, this consists of breath analyzer test or blood-test documents; in assault or domestic physical violence instances, it usually consists of medical records and injury pictures. Independent investigation. A solid defense does not count just on the police version. Your attorney might interview witnesses, visit the scene (from Colfax Avenue website traffic quits to events near Washington Park or Sloan's Lake), request security video from nearby businesses, and seek inconsistent declarations that can assist your case. Early activities and legal rights protection. If the cops violated your legal rights-- such as executing a prohibited stop, search, or interrogation-- your lawyer can submit motions to subdue evidence. In Denver courts, an effective suppression activity can cause decreased charges or perhaps dismissal, especially in medicine and DUI cases. Arraignment and first appeal decisions. At arraignment, you officially hear the charges and enter an appeal. With guidance from your lawyer, you generally start by pleading not guilty. This preserves your legal rights while your lawyer proceeds checking out and negotiating. You likewise obtain future court dates, consisting of pre-trial meetings and hearings. Plea arrangements and method meetings. The prosecutor and your lawyer may review feasible resolutions, such as lowered costs, diversion programs, or alternate sentencing. Your lawyer discusses each deal in plain language-- just how it affects your record, work, specialist licenses, immigration standing, and ability to secure or remove the instance later. Preparing for trial or last hearing. If no acceptable arrangement is reached, the case might proceed to trial. Prep work consists of developing a concept of defense, preparing how to cross-examine law enforcement agent and witnesses, deciding whether you will certainly testify, and establishing exhibitions like diagrams, timelines, or digital proof. Sentencing advocacy. If you are convicted or accept a plea, your lawyer argues for the lightest possible sentence. That can include presenting mitigation: your work history, household obligations, therapy or treatment you have actually finished, and letters of assistance. In Denver, courts frequently consider community-based sentences like probation, classes, or social work as opposed to jail, specifically for newbie offenders. Post-conviction and record securing guidance. After the instance finishes, your attorney can clarify whether you may later be eligible for document securing and what actions to require to recover civil liberties, avoid probation offenses, or adhere to DMV demands in DUI or significant website traffic cases.

Common Criminal Costs and Regional Concerns in Denver

Life in Denver mixes city night life, outside recreation, and varied neighborhoods. That mix can additionally bring about certain types of criminal cases and persisting legal troubles. A few of one of the most common circumstances homeowners and visitors encounter below include DUIs, domestic physical violence accusations, assaults, and severe traffic offenses.

DUI and DWAI charges. Denver's bar and restaurant districts-- LoDo, RiNo, and around Coors Area-- are constant hotspots for late-night DUI stops. Cops see closely for weaving, speeding, or small web traffic mistakes near closing time. Even a very first DUI can bring permit suspension, penalties, probation, courses, and feasible prison. High BAC levels or mishaps can press charges greater. A local attorney comprehends exactly how Denver courts and DMV hearings usually take care of these instances.

Domestic physical violence and misconceptions at home. In apartment-heavy neighborhoods like Capitol Hill, Baker, and areas near Cheesman Park, noise problems can rapidly become cops feedbacks. Colorado law motivates police officers to make an apprehension when there is any type of indication of residential violence, even if both individuals are dismayed or the tale is unclear. This frequently results in "he claimed, she stated" instances where the authorities record does not record the full photo. A defense lawyer helps type with contrasting tales, text messages, and clinical documents to offer your side.

Assault costs after fights. Debates outside bars, at sporting events, and even at events in City Park or Washington Park can intensify into physical fights. Relying on the injuries and whether a weapon is affirmed, an easy push can result in a misdemeanor, while more severe injury can bring felony assault costs. Colorado's regulations on "warmth of interest" and self-defense are complicated; a neighborhood lawyer can argue that you were safeguarding yourself or that the situation does not fit the state's meaning of felony attack.

Traffic and automotive offenses. Speeding up on I-70, I-25, or heading right into the hills may begin as a traffic ticket yet can transform major if there is too much rate, declared racing, or an accident. Costs like negligent driving or automobile attack include feasible jail and long-term permit effects. These instances typically rest on mishap repair, witness statements, and whether your conduct really fulfilled the legal standard for "negligent" or "reckless."

Immigration-related risks. For several Denver citizens, specifically in multilingual communities along Federal Blvd or in Westwood and Barnum, a criminal instance is more than fines or jail time. Specific convictions can result in deportation or make it impossible to acquire lawful status. A criminal lawyer that comprehends these dangers will factor them into every negotiation, working with or coordinating advice from an immigration lawyer when needed.

Key Considerations and Prices When Employing a Criminal Lawyer in Denver

Choosing the best criminal lawyer is one of the most vital choices you will make after an apprehension. Cost matters, but so does experience, interaction design, and just how clearly the lawyer clarifies your choices. Below are the major variables to consider as you evaluate your selections.

1. Type and seriousness of the charge. A minor traffic infraction or community ordinance violation usually costs much less to handle than a felony assault, domestic physical violence, or DUI with a crash. Extra serious costs commonly call for multiple court looks, expert witnesses, and intricate legal activities. The more work your lawyer have to do to fully explore and protect you, the higher the charge is most likely to be.

2. Lawyer's experience and focus. A lawyer that on a regular basis handles Denver criminal situations brings expertise of regional courts, prosecutors, and court procedures. That familiarity can assist in predicting likely results and crafting arrangement methods. While a very skilled lawyer might bill more than a general practitioner, the value commonly appears in minimized charges, rejected fees, or far better long-lasting outcomes.

3. Flat fees vs. per hour billing. Lots of criminal defense lawyer in Denver use flat-fee prices, specifically for DUI, domestic violence, or conventional offense cases. A level fee offers you predictability: you recognize the cost for depiction with a particular phase, such as up to test or with sentencing. Hourly payment still exists, especially in intricate felony or multi-defendant situations, but it can be more challenging to forecast the last total.

4. Court costs, penalties, and classes. Lawyer's charges are only component of the financial picture. Depending on your case, you might also encounter court prices, probation guidance costs, therapy or therapy programs, drunk driving education, target influence panels, or ignition interlock devices. An excellent lawyer will prepare you for these prospective expenses up front, so there are no surprises later.

5. Security consequences. The "surprise costs" of a conviction can be more than the fine. A criminal record can influence employment, real estate, expert licenses, gun rights, and immigration standing. Prior to you approve any kind of appeal deal, your lawyer ought to discuss the long-term influence in simple terms. Spending for a stronger defense now may conserve you years of difficulty later.

6. Communication and trust. You need to really feel listened to, valued, and educated. Seek a lawyer who addresses your questions clearly, maintains you upgraded on court days, and prepares you for every step-- from accusation to final hearing. Comfortable communication is specifically essential if English is not your first language or if you have actually never remained in court before.

7. Settlement options. Some companies provide layaway plan, especially for longer situations. Ask what is consisted of in the estimated cost (as an example, pre-trial job only or test depiction also) and what would cost added. Comprehending the full economic photo at the start assists you prevent stress and anxiety later on.
